Bug Description

The following failures:
Test 53-sim-binary_tree%%034-00001 result: FAILURE bpf_sim resulted in ALLOW
Test 53-sim-binary_tree%%035-00001 result: FAILURE bpf_sim resulted in ALLOW
Test 53-sim-binary_tree%%036-00001 result: FAILURE bpf_sim resulted in ALLOW

Can be found on:
4.15.0-92.93 - PoewrPC / s390x / i386
4.4.0-177 - PoewrPC / s390x / i386

Please find the complete test log with 4.4.0-177 in the attachment of comment 5.
